SPIF1 and SPIF2 commands are used to switch over between the first and second punching
interface.
Note
Requirement: A second I/O pair has to be defined for the punching functionality in the machine
data (→ see machine manufacturer's specifications).
Syntax
PON G... X... Y... Z...
SON G... X... Y... Z...
SONS G... X... Y... Z...
PONS G... X... Y... Z...
PDELAYON
PDELAYOF
PUNCHACC(<Smin>,<Amin>,<Smax>,<Amax>)
SPIF1/SPIF2
SPOF
Meaning
PON: Activate punching.
SON: Activate nibbling
PONS: Activate punching with leader.
SONS: Activate nibbling with leader.
SPOF: Deactivate punching/nibbling.
PDELAYON: Activate punching with delay.
PDELAYOF: Deactivate punching with delay.
PUNCHACC: Activate travel-dependent acceleration.
Parameter:
<Smin> Minimum hole spacing
<Amin> Initial acceleration
<Amin> can be greater than <Amax>.
<Smax> Maximum hole spacing
<Amax> Final acceleration
<Amax> can be greater than <Amin>.
SPIF1: Activate first punching interface.
The stroke is controlled using the first pair of fast I/O.
SPIF2: Activate second punching interface.
The stroke is controlled using the second pair of fast I/O.
Note:
The first punch interface is always active after a RESET or control system power up.
If only one punching interface is used, then it need not be programmed.
